sulphuric acid pump

A sulphuric acid pump is a specialized industrial equipment designed to handle the safe and efficient transfer of sulphuric acid across various processing applications. The sulphuric acid pump represents a critical component in chemical manufacturing, refining operations, and waste treatment facilities where corrosive fluid management is essential. These pumps are engineered with advanced materials and sealing technologies to withstand the highly corrosive nature of sulphuric acid while maintaining reliable performance. The main functions of a sulphuric acid pump include transferring concentrated or diluted sulphuric acid between storage tanks, reactors, and processing units with precision and safety. A sulphuric acid pump operates through centrifugal or positive displacement mechanisms, depending on specific application requirements and flow rate demands. The technological features of modern sulphuric acid pump systems include dual mechanical seals, non-metallic wetted components, and advanced bearing designs that prevent acid penetration and leakage. Industries relying on sulphuric acid pump technology include battery manufacturing, fertilizer production, steel pickling, chemical processing, and environmental remediation. The sulphuric acid pump enables consistent acid delivery while protecting personnel and equipment from dangerous exposure. Advanced monitoring systems integrated into contemporary sulphuric acid pump designs provide real-time performance data and predictive maintenance alerts. These pumps accommodate various acid concentrations, temperatures, and viscosity levels, making them indispensable in demanding industrial environments where reliability and safety cannot be compromised.

Advanced Corrosion-Resistant Design

Advanced Corrosion-Resistant Design

The sulphuric acid pump incorporates state-of-the-art materials specifically selected to withstand extreme corrosive conditions. Non-metallic components, including engineered polymers and specialized coatings, prevent degradation while maintaining structural integrity. The sulphuric acid pump housing utilizes duplex stainless steel and advanced rubber linings that create multiple protective barriers against acid penetration. This innovative construction ensures extended service life, reducing replacement frequency and minimizing operational interruptions. The sulphuric acid pump's design eliminates weak points where corrosion typically initiates, protecting critical sealing surfaces and bearing assemblies. Users benefit from dramatically reduced maintenance costs and enhanced reliability compared to conventional equipment. The thoughtful engineering of every sulphuric acid pump component demonstrates manufacturer commitment to durability and customer satisfaction in demanding industrial environments.
